1、throughout
自始至終;從頭到尾;貫穿
The national tragedy of rival groups killing each other continued throughout 1990.
敵對派別相互殘殺的國家悲劇 1990 年全年都在上演。
Movie music can be made memorable because its themes are repeated throughout the film.
電影音樂要想讓人記住不難,因為它的主旋律貫穿影片始終。
遍及;遍布
'Sight Savers', founded in 1950, now runs projects throughout Africa, the Caribbean and South East Asia.
創始于 1950 年的國際防盲及救盲組織如今在非洲、加勒比海地區和東南亞各地都開展項目。
As we have tried to show throughout this book, companies that provide outstanding service don't do it by luck.
正如我們一直想在本書中努力表明的那樣,提供優質服務的公司靠的不是運氣。
2、come out
(書或光盤)出版,發行
The book comes out this week.
這本書本周出版。
Christian Slater has a new movie coming out next month in which he plays a vigilante.
克里斯汀·史萊特有一部新片下月發行,他在片中扮演一個治安維持會成員。
(事實)暴露,披露,顯露
The truth is beginning to come out about what happened.
真相開始逐漸浮出水面。
It will come out that she has covertly donated considerable sums to the IRA.
她暗中給愛爾蘭共和軍提供了大筆資助的事情即將曝光。
結果是;到頭來
In this grim little episode of recent American history, few people come out well.
在美國近代史上這一小段陰暗時期,很少有人能有好的結果。
So what makes a good marriage? Faithfulness comes out top of the list.
那么,是什么造就了美滿的婚姻呢?結果表明忠誠是第一位的。
